The judicial system that serves Penelope is primarily represented by the Hill County District Court, which adjudicates a variety of civil and criminal cases. To obtain court records in Penelope, individuals can use the online portal provided by the court or visit the courthouse in person to speak with the clerk. The clerk's office is a valuable resource for accessing various legal documents and records. For vital records such as birth, death, and marriage certificates, residents can contact the Hill County Clerk or access the Texas vital records through the state’s online services. Property records are managed by the county assessor and recorder’s offices, and these too can be accessed via online portals, helping with property inquiries and transactions. Public records requests can be made under the Texas Public Information Act, which typically mandates a response within 5 to 10 business days. Texas doesn’t have a single database where you can search all court records for the state. Each court is responsible for keeping their own records. Some courts make their records available online, but you may have to contact the court clerk to get access and pay a service fee.
